Seeking an experienced leader to manage local capital funding programs on behalf of 15 cities in the fast-growing East King County region. A Regional Coalition for Housing (ARCH) is dedicated to creating equitable, inclusive communities of opportunity through investment, policy development, program delivery and direct support for people looking for affordable rental and ownership housing.

The ARCH Investments Manager oversees the collective set of local capital funding sources and programs that support the development of affordable housing in East King County, together with local planning and pre-development support to initiate projects in member jurisdictions. The position is responsible for supervising 3-4 positions and structuring an effective team that meets core program functions as well as longer-term strategic objectives. This entails management of staff and internal systems and procedures, as well as building external relationship with diverse partners, including nonprofit and for-profit housing providers, city executive, planning and human services staff, and other public and private lenders and investors.

The ARCH Investments Manager is a senior leader on the ARCH team, reporting to the Executive Director, with the opportunity to shape the strategic direction of affordable housing investment and development in the region.In this role, you will undertake the following responsibilities:

  • Manage a team of 3-4 staff responsible for administering local capital funding programs for affordable housing in the ARCH region, including:

  • Recruit, hire and train new staff

  • Develop and oversee staff work plans and review performance

  • Support ongoing professional development

  • Create clear lines of communication and responsibilities to foster an effective team

  • Oversee Investment team implementation of ARCH's annual funding round, ensuring timely reviews of funding proposals, coordination with other public funders and development of funding recommendations through collaboration with member staff and the ARCH Community Advisory Board.

  • Ensure efficient, integrated internal processes to jointly administer multiple capital funding and operations/services sources, including local and federal sources that support the ARCH Housing Trust Fund, Bellevue Housing Stability Program funds, and other emerging sources.

  • Establish and assign team responsibilities for project management as well as ongoing monitoring of funded projects, and pursue interagency agreements and partnerships to monitor long-term agreements.

  • Oversee interdepartmental collaboration within the City of Bellevue, ARCH's Administering Agency, to ensure timely execution and administration of funding contracts and covenants.

  • Maintain positive working relationships with ARCH member city funding partners and demonstrate strong stewardship of local funding.

  • Oversee ARCH's work to provide local planning and pre-development support to cities and other community partners to initiate special projects, providing expertise on financing and deal structuring.

  • Pursue external partnerships to attract other public and private capital investments in affordable housing in the ARCH region.

  • Work with the ARCH Executive Director to support implementation of ARCH's Strategic Plan, including supporting policy and legislative strategies that advance funding for affordable housing.

  • Prepare and make presentations to city councils and other audiences.

  • Represent ARCH cities in local, regional and State committees and work groups.

E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E

This position requires a diverse set of skills that may be demonstrated from a combination of education and work experience, including:

  • Bachelor's degree in a relevant field such as finance, business, public administration, accounting, real estate development, urban planning, etc.

  • Master's degree in a relevant field is a plus.

  • Seven or more years of work experience in one or more relevant fields, including but not limited to lending, finance, contracts, land use, real estate development, and urban planning.

  • Alternatively, an equivalent combination of education, experience, and training that provides the required mix of knowledge, skills and abilities.

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S and ABILITIES

  • Management and supervisory experience, including ability to plan, schedule, assign, coordinate, and monitor the work of professional and technical staff.

  • Ability to plan, implement, and coordinate comprehensive programs and projects.

  • Ability to evaluate internal systems and procedures and make improvements that maximize program effectiveness.

  • Extensive knowledge of affordable housing financing and underwriting.

  • Understanding of development review and planning principles, policies and regulations as they relate to residential and mixed use development.

  • Experience with a diverse range of affordable housing development projects utilizing different financing programs and serving a variety of populations.

  • Understanding of affordable housing operations and integration of supportive services

  • Strong verbal and written communication skills.

  • Experience building strong relationships with customers, colleagues and the public.

  • Other skills or licenses (architectural, engineering, urban planning, law, or accounting) are a plus.

  • A demonstrated commitment to creating diverse, equitable communities.

Limited Term Employee (LTE): A fully benefited employee appointed to serve in a position scheduled to work a minimum of 30 hours a week for a specific project with a specific ending date which is anticipated to last more than five months but in no event longer than three consecutive years (36 months).
